Cunard celebrates the float out of Queen Anne with milestone ceremony in Italy
The world’s most iconic luxury cruise brand celebrated a momentous construction milestone with the float out of Queen Anne at the Fincantieri Marghera shipyard in Venice, Italy.
Luigi Matarazzo, General Manager Merchant Ships Division of Fincantieri, stated: “Queen Anne is the third ship we have the pleasure to build for Cunard, a pillar in the history of British seafaring, with whom we share a real commitment to excellence. Building a liner for this shipowner takes us back to our roots yet, at the same time, spurs us forward to the future in a spirit of determination to bring together tradition and innovation and further strengthen our longstanding relationship”.
The float out, completes the first comprehensive phase of construction for Queen Anne, which now transitions to focus on building the luxury ship’s interiors.
